The US army is looking for a (civilian) patent attorney with 2+ years of experience.  Duty location appears to be in Natick, MA. Pay is ~125-160k. 

Full job description is available at:

http://jobview.usajobs.gov/GetJob.aspx?OPMControl=1904140&caller=ftva.asp

Thought I would bring it to the attention of the board members, just in case someone is looking for a new position.  The pay isn't great, but the experience and benefits likely make up for it.
